Causes of cystoid macular edema

There are many known causes of cystoid macular edema. These include: Eye surgery, including cataract surgery and repair of a detached retina Diabetes Age-related macular degeneration Blockage in veins of the retina (e.g., retinal vein occlusion) Inflammation of the eye Injury to the eye Side effects of medications
